MT to ET Conversion Guide

What is MT to ET Conversion?

MT to ET conversion helps you translate time between Mountain Time and Eastern Time zones in the United States. Mountain Time includes MDT (UTC-6) during daylight saving and MST (UTC-7) during standard time. Eastern Time includes EDT (UTC-4) during daylight saving and EST (UTC-5) during standard time. The time difference between these zones is consistently 2 hours, with ET being ahead.

Time Zone Information

Mountain Time (MT): Used in states like Colorado, Utah, Wyoming, Montana, and parts of others. Switches between MDT (UTC-6) in summer and MST (UTC-7) in winter. Note: Arizona stays on MST year-round.
Eastern Time (ET): Used in states like New York, Florida, Georgia, and parts of others. Switches between EDT (UTC-4) in summer and EST (UTC-5) in winter.
Time Difference: ET is consistently 2 hours ahead of MT year-round. Both zones change together for Daylight Saving Time.

Daylight Saving Time Impact

DST Period: Runs from the second Sunday in March (2025: March 9) to the first Sunday in November (2025: November 2)
Summer Time: MDT (UTC-6) and EDT (UTC-4) - both zones are 1 hour ahead of their standard time
Winter Time: MST (UTC-7) and EST (UTC-5) - both zones use their standard time offsets
Consistent Difference: The 2-hour time difference remains constant as both zones change simultaneously

Conversion Tips & Best Practices

Simply add 2 hours to MT to get ET - this rule works year-round
Both zones change for Daylight Saving Time on the same dates, maintaining the 2-hour difference
Arizona (except Navajo Nation) stays on MST year-round and doesn't observe DST
Some parts of Idaho, Oregon, and other states have counties in Mountain Time
Stock market opens at 7:30 AM MT (9:30 AM ET) and closes at 2:00 PM MT (4:00 PM ET)
During DST transitions at 2:00 AM, be extra careful with early morning scheduling
